How Our Retail Store Water Damage Restoration Process Works
At our company, we understand the importance of a proper process with retail store water damage restoration. We can’t stress enough how critical it is to act quickly in the first 24-48 hours after damage occurs. That’s why our team is available 24/7 to respond to your emergency and get started on the restoration process right away.
Step 1: Emergency Response and Assessment
Our team will arrive at your property within 60 minutes to assess the damage and provide a detailed estimate of the work needed. This is a crucial step in the process, as it will find out the scope of the work and the estimated cost. Our team will also identify any potential safety hazards and take steps to mitigate them.
Step 2: Water Removal and Drying
Our team will use specialized equipment, including truck-mounted extractors and dehumidifiers, to remove standing water and dry your property. This step is critical in preventing further damage and promoting a safe and healthy environment for your customers and employees.
Step 3: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the water and moisture have been removed, our team will clean and sanitize your property to prevent the growth of mold and mildew. This step is especially important in retail stores, where customers are present and can be exposed to potential health risks.
Step 4: Reconstruction and Repair
Our team will work with you to identify and repair any damage to your property, including walls, floors, and inventory. We’ll use high-quality materials and construction techniques to ensure your retail store is restored to its original condition.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Quality Control
Once the reconstruction and repair work are compl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your property is safe and secure. We’ll also provide a detailed report and warranty information to give you peace of mind and protect your investment.

Retail Store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Standing water in a small area (less than 100 sq. Ft.) | Yes | No | DIY methods can handle small areas, but be sure to follow safety guidelines and take necessary precautions. |
| Water damage to a large area (over 100 sq. Ft.)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to handle large areas and prevent further damage. |
| Water damage to inventory or sensitive equipment |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to handle sensitive equipment and prevent further damage or data loss. |
| Water damage with potential health risks (e.g., mold, mildew)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to handle potential health risks and prevent further damage or illness. |
| Water damage to a complex system (e.g., HVAC, electrical)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to handle complex systems and prevent further damage or safety hazards. |
Don’t try to tackle retail store water damage restoration on your own. While DIY methods may be suitable for small areas, large areas, and sensitive equipment need professional equipment and expertise to prevent further damage and ensure a safe and healthy environment for your customers and employees.
Retail Store Water Damage Restoration Cost in Norwalk, IA
The cost of retail store water damage restoration in Norwalk, IA can v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Response and Assessment |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ions. |
| Water Removal and Dr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and number of personnel required.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$1,000 – $3,000 | Type of cleaning and sanitizing methods required, size of affected area, and number of personnel required. |
| Reconstruction and Rep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and type of materials required. |
| Final Inspection and Quality Control |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and number of personnel required. |

Is Retail Store Water Damage Restoration a Health Risk?
Yes, retail store water damage restoration can pose a health risk if not handled properly. Standing water and poor ventilation can lead to the growth of mold and mildew, which can cause a range of health problems, including respiratory issues, allergic reactions, and even serious illnesses.
